FACT 33: DRACULA

For my senior seminar project I am researching Bram Stoker's Dracula and its film adaptation to see the differences. I came across this interesting fact in my reading.

"By the time of Dracula's publication, Bram Stoker served as the acting manager of the Lyceum Theatre for seventeen years, the right-hand man and confidante of its impresario, the great Victorian actor Sir Henry Irving," (David J. Skal).
